Water was everywhere and that was a good thing for the Imperial Volunteer Fire Department’s Helen Fanning Memorial Family Fun Day July 4. With temperatures surpassing 100 degrees, water felt good, even if it was in the face as Tanner Roenfeldt and Ashton Robinson, left, receive in a water gun fight. Water was also plentiful for the FFA-sponsored volleyball tourney. Below right, Kerry Shinn attempts a block, then fell back into the water. At bottom, the winning water fight team in the competition that day, from left, Adam Crapson, Lucas Harms and Dalton Harms, took home $60 in Chamber Bucks provided by the IVFD. IVFD auxiliary members, below from left, Ann Kelley, Sonya Schilke and Terri Dillan, serve up one of the free hot dogs. (Republican photos)
